About Gary Grant
His clinical orientation began with the client-centered approach of Carl Rogers and evolved into an integrative practice focused on recovery, resilience, and client strengths. He has extensive experience working with LGBTQ clients and with communities on reservations and in rural settings, including six years on the Salish-Kootenai Reservation in Montana and four years with Alaskan Native populations in Fairbanks. Gary has also worked with adolescents in residential settings using positive peer orientation methods, providing individual, group, and family therapies across cultural contexts.
Gary's academic background includes a Bachelor of Arts with majors in psychology and sociology and research in suicidality, a Master of Education in psychology, guidance, and counseling, and a Master of Fine Arts with coursework in theatre and group psychotherapy. He completed major clinical psychology coursework toward a PsyD and trained in clinical hypnotherapy with Jack and Helen Watkins, incorporating Ego-State Therapy techniques. His recent work has involved group therapy and mindfulness training for emotional regulation, addressing depression, anxiety, PTSD related to violence and severe abuse, anger management, bipolar disorder, and cognitive approaches to psychosis in collaboration with psychiatric teams.

Therapeutic Approaches and Online Care
Gary Grant combines well-established therapeutic methods to address a wide range of concerns. Client-Centered Therapy focuses on a compassionate, nonjudgmental relationship in which the therapist supports the client's own capacity for growth and self-understanding - this approach is helpful for building self-esteem, navigating life transitions, and strengthening interpersonal connections.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) targets unhelpful thought patterns and behaviors, offering practical strategies to reduce symptoms of anxiety, depression, and stress and to improve coping skills for everyday challenges.
Hypnotherapy, as Gary practices it, uses guided relaxation and focused attention to help clients access internal resources and explore patterns of emotion and behavior; it can be useful for issues like trauma-related symptoms, habit change, and emotional regulation.
Finding the right approach is part of the therapeutic journey. He works collaboratively with each person to identify methods that fit their needs, goals, and preferences, adjusting techniques over time as progress emerges and circumstances change.
